Analog Devices LTC7880 | Demoboard DC2728A

60V Dual Output Step-Up Controller with Digital Power System Management

Overview

TopologyBoost Converter
Input voltage12-24 V
Output 148 V / 5 A
Output 248 V / 5 A

Description

The LTC®7880 is a dual PolyPhase® DC/DC synchronous step-up switching regulator controller with I2C-based PMBus compliant serial interface. This controller employs a constant-frequency, current-mode architecture, with high voltage input and output capability along with programmable loop compensation. The LTC7880 is supported by the LTpowerPlay™ software development tool with graphical user interface (GUI). Switching frequency, output voltage, and device address can be programmed both by digital interface as well as external configuration resistors. Parameters can be set via the digital interface or stored in EEPROM. The gate drive for the LTC7880 can be programmed from 6.3V to 9V to maximize efficiency. Both outputs have an independent power good indicator and FAULT function. The LTC7880 can be configured for discontinuous (pulseskipping) mode or continuous inductor current mode.

Features

  • PMBus/I2C Compliant Serial Interface
    • Telemetry Read-Back Includes Input and Output Voltage and Current, Temperature and Faults
    • Programmable Voltage, Current Limit, Digital Soft-Start/Stop, Sequencing, Margining, OV/UV/OC, Frequency, and Control Loop Compensation
  • Output Error Less Than ±0.5% Over Temperature
  • Integrated 16-Bit ADC and 12-Bit DAC
  • Internal EEPROM with ECC and Fault Logging
  • Integrated N-Channel MOSFET Gate Drivers
  • Power Conversion
    • Wide Input Voltage Range: 5V to 40V
    • Operates Down to 2.5V After Start-Up
    • VOUT0, VOUT1 Range: Up to 60V
    • Analog Current Mode Control
    • Accurate PolyPhase® Current Sharing for Up to 6 Phases (50kHz to 500kHz)
    • Available in a 52-Lead (7mm × 8mm) QFN Package

Typical applications

  • Automotive Always-On and Start-Stop Systems / Industrial and Point of Load Applications
